DIY Recipe: Crawfish Boil - In a Pot!

We went to a a crawfish boil last night, had lots of fun, and then brought the fun home with us. This afternoon, my sister Casey and I gathered the leftovers and threw this together for a Crawfish Corn Sausage Potato Soup.....aka, Crawfish Boil - In a Pot!


Okay, so we had a gallon-size Ziploc bag full of whole crawfish, and when we peeled them, it looked about 2 or 3 cups of tail meat, but just peel as many as you have.


Finely chop 1/2 of an onion, and a stalk of celery. We'll get to the garlic later.


Melt 3 or 4 tbsp. of butter in a big pot. Go ahead and put 4 tbsp. Remember to smile as you melt it.


Throw in the onion and celery into the big pot.


And stir. And stir some more.


Now finely chop 2 cloves of garlic and dump it into the big pot, so it can make friends with Mr. Onion and Ms. Celery.
                 

Cut the kernels off of your corn cobs and start dumping it into the big pot.


Like this. (Or you can use frozen corn, if you don't have corn cobs)


Here are all of the kernels.


Here are all of the cobs. 


Now dice your potatoes, slice your sausage, and dump them along with the crawfish into........yep, the big pot.

Now pour five cups of chicken broth into the big pot. 


Now add about a tbsp. of Paul Prudhomme's Seafood Magic seasoning, 3 tbsp. of sugar, and one big bayleaf, or two little ones. We are LEAFing this up to you. My sister and I are so punny. (budumbump CYMBAL CRASH!) Now cover the big pot and let it simmer so it can mingle, while you mix up a batch of Angel Biscuits to accompany your soup.
